It will be a lot easier for you to attract cheaper Illinois home insurance rates if you take note of this: A Named Peril policy and an All Risk policy are the options you’d have to choose from when you want to purchase a homeowners’ insurance policy. As its name implies, a named peril policy offers coverage from risks mentioned in the policy while an all risk policy offers you coverage from all possible risks except such that is particularly excluded in the policy.
A named peril policy is definitely the cheaper chioce. Nevertheless, ensure that you’ll enjoy adequate coverage before you make your final decision. If it doesn’t give you adequate coverage then you’re well-advised to look for other ways of saving. You may regret it greatly if you go for it even if it is not adequate.
